

-Abandonment of US citizenship can be done in one of the US Consulates in China (only can be done outside US). Just contact the US Consulate in China for the procedure. Once she gives up the US citizenship, she will not get it again. Techincally, she can reinstate their Chinese citizenship after she gives up her US citizenhsip, but I don't know the extact procedure. They may contact 當地公安部門 to see how to reinstate the Chinese citizenship. However, this is serious issue, so before she gives up her US citizenship, she had better know whether she can reinstate her Chinese citizenship and know how to do it.

Another choice is that she may try to see whether she can get the Chinese permanent residency ("Chinese green card") and it seems it may be doable for old Chinese-American like her.
